The Oley Valley is a valley 10 miles (16 km) northeast of Reading, Pennsylvania.It covers all of Oley, Pike, Ruscombmanor, Alsace, and part of Exeter Township.The valley is drained by Manatawny and Pine Creeks, and is a part of the Schuylkill River system.

The Salt Lake City School District (SLCSD) is the oldest public school district in Utah. Boundaries for the district are identical to the city limits for Salt Lake City . Employing about 1,300 teachers who instruct about 25,000 students K-12 , the district is the ninth largest in the state, as of 2009, behind Granite , Davis , Alpine , Jordan ...
Oley Township was originally formed in 1740 as a part of Philadelphia County, before Berks County was formed in 1752. The entire township was listed as a historic district by the National Register of Historic Places in 1983. [4] Oley is a Native American name purported to mean "a hollow".
